Shah Rukh Khan was reportedly in discussions with Dinesh Vijan and Amar Kaushik for a project titled Chamunda. Earlier, Pinkvilla had reported that Alia Bhatt was also in talks for the same film. Unfortunately, recent updates suggest that Shah Rukh Khan has declined the project, citing his preference not to join an already-established cinematic universe. According to Bollywood Hungama, Shah Rukh Khan was approached for the lead role in Chamunda, a project intended to be a pivotal installment in Maddock Films’ horror-comedy universe. A source revealed that the film, directed by Amar Kaushik and starring Alia Bhatt, was a priority for Maddock, who were eager to cast Shah Rukh Khan. However, the collaboration did not materialize. The source further explained that Shah Rukh Khan preferred not to join an already-established cinematic universe and expressed interest in starting a fresh project with Maddock and Amar Kaushik. In 2018, Dinesh Vijan delivered a blockbuster in the horror comedy space with Shraddha Kapoor and Rajkummar Rao in the form of Stree. The filmmaker continued to curate content in the genre over the years, and won over the audience in the post-pandemic world too with Bhediya, Munjya, and Stree 2. The love won by these films also helped Maddock Films set up a one-of-its kind horror comedy universe. Come 2025, Maddock Films are all set to expand the universe further and the newest three additions to the line-up are Thama, Shakti Shalini, and Chamunda. Pinkvilla has exclusively learnt that Maddock Films is all set to embark on their most ambitious venture till date – a visionary, interconnected cinematic universe of horror-comedy superhero universe. Alia Bhatt is one of the most celebrated of Hindi Cinema in modern times, with a track record like no-one else. The actress recently wrapped up shooting for the YRF Spy Universe film, Alpha, and jumped into the world of Sanjay Leela Bhansali’s Love And War with Ranbir Kapoor and Vicky Kaushal. Alia has allotted bulk dates until November 2025 to SLB, and has begun the hunt for a film to go on floors post that. Pinkvilla has exclusively learnt that Alia Bhatt is in talks with Dinesh Vijan for a feature film. According to sources close to the development, Alia Bhatt has been paying a visit to Maddock’s office to discuss a supernatural horror thriller. “Alia has always discussed multiple feature films with Dinesh Vijan and is now on the verge of collaborating with the producer. The actress has loved a psychological supernatural thriller, which could be her next after Love And for the big screen.
